The Google Pixel Fold represents Google’s ambitious foray into the foldable smartphone arena, a device meticulously crafted to bridge the gap between a pocketable smartphone and a versatile tablet. Its design hinges on a unique form factor: when closed, it presents a relatively compact, almost square-ish exterior display, a deliberate choice to offer a more traditional smartphone experience without the elongated aspect ratio often found in other foldables. This outer screen, a vibrant 5.8-inch OLED panel with a 120Hz refresh rate, ensures a fluid and responsive interaction for everyday tasks like messaging, browsing, and quick app usage. The real magic, however, unfolds with the internal display. A generous 7.6-inch foldable AMOLED screen, also boasting a 120Hz refresh rate, transforms the Pixel Fold into a miniature tablet. This expansive canvas is ideal for multitasking, immersive media consumption, and productivity-oriented applications. Google’s emphasis on a less pronounced crease in the foldable display is a testament to their engineering prowess, aiming to minimize visual distraction and enhance the overall user experience.
Under the hood, the Pixel Fold is powered by Google’s Tensor G2 chip, the same sophisticated silicon found in their flagship Pixel 7 and 7 Pro smartphones. This chip is not merely about raw processing power; it’s a machine learning powerhouse, enabling advanced computational photography, robust on-device AI features, and efficient power management. The camera system on the Pixel Fold is another area where Google’s expertise shines. It features a versatile triple-lens rear setup, including a primary 48MP sensor, a 10.8MP ultrawide lens, and a 10.8MP telephoto lens with 5x optical zoom. This combination allows for exceptional photographic versatility, capturing detailed shots in various lighting conditions and offering impressive zoom capabilities. Selfie cameras are integrated on both the outer and inner displays, ensuring seamless video calls and self-portraits regardless of the device’s folded state. Battery life is managed by a substantial 4881 mAh battery, designed to sustain the demands of both displays and intensive usage, further enhanced by Google’s AI-driven power optimization.
The software experience on the Pixel Fold is intrinsically tied to Android, with Google leveraging its deep integration to optimize for the foldable form factor. This includes enhanced multitasking capabilities, such as a split-screen view that can accommodate up to three apps, and a taskbar that mimics the desktop experience, allowing for quick app switching and drag-and-drop functionality. Google’s commitment to providing a refined Android experience, tailored for foldables, positions the Pixel Fold as a device that truly embraces its dual nature. The build quality of the Pixel Fold is premium, featuring a robust hinge mechanism designed for durability and a refined aesthetic. The device is also IPX8 water-resistant, adding a layer of practical resilience. Now, to provide a historical and comparative context, let’s consider the OnePlus 2, a device that, while a traditional slab smartphone from a different era, represented a significant moment in the evolution of Android devices. Launched in 2015, the OnePlus 2 was a bold move for a relatively new company aiming to challenge established giants. Its design was a departure from the plastic found in its predecessor, featuring a more premium construction with a metal frame and interchangeable back covers made from materials like bamboo and Kevlar. The display was a 5.5-inch IPS LCD panel with a resolution of 1920 x 1080 pixels, a standard for flagship phones at the time, offering sharp visuals but lacking the high refresh rates and dynamic AMOLED technology of modern devices.
Underneath its elegant exterior, the OnePlus 2 housed a Qualcomm Snapdragon 810 processor, which, while powerful in its day, was also plagued by thermal throttling issues. It was paired with either 3GB or 4GB of RAM, providing respectable multitasking capabilities for 2015. The camera system was a single 13MP rear sensor with optical image stabilization and a 5MP front-facing camera. While these specifications were competitive at the time of its release, they fall considerably short of the computational photography prowess and sensor sizes found in today’s smartphones, let alone a foldable device like the Pixel Fold. The battery was a non-removable 3300 mAh unit, offering decent longevity for its era, and it supported Quick Charge 2.0 for faster charging.
The software on the OnePlus 2 ran OxygenOS, a custom Android skin that was lauded for its clean interface and minimal bloatware. It offered a relatively close-to-stock Android experience with a few thoughtful additions. However, software updates were not as consistent or long-lasting as what users expect today. The OnePlus 2 was significant for its "flagship killer" marketing, offering premium features at a more accessible price point compared to top-tier devices from Samsung and Apple. It also championed the adoption of USB Type-C, a forward-thinking move at the time.
